Google Maps Previews In Gmail and Google’s World Cup Easter Egg

The Gmail team has introduced an interesting new Labs feature. And a quite useful one too. It’s called Google Maps previews, and as the name suggests, it shows the addresses mentioned in the mail on Google Maps, right inside Gmail.

Google Buzz Is Late to the Social-Networking Party

Google integrated its latest email program known as Buzz into Gmail. It is regarded as an opt-in social network with the help of which people are able to share Twitter tweets, videos, photos, status updates, blog posts and Web links with friends from a network.
